THE City Council committee on environment chaired by Councilor Roger Abaday will take up the request of the University of Science and Technology of Southern Philippines to partner with the city government to conduct a seminar on environmental awareness, sustainability practices, and responsible stewardship on natural resources.

Dr. RJ Krista Raye Leocadio, head of the department of environmental science and technology of the college of science and mathematics, stated in her letter to Mayor Rolando Klarex Uy through Councilor Abaday that it is part of their university’s ongoing effort in supporting local and national efforts in protecting the environment through information drive.
As such the university is seeking the assistance of the City to identify key areas which would benefit from the said knowledge-building program.
The presence of City Administrator Atty. Roy Hilario Raagas, City Legal Officer Atty. Kenneth Tamala, CLENRO Head Engr. Armen Cuenca, and Dr. RJ Krista Raye Leocadio are requested.
Also invited are Ms. Roxanne Mae Ravidas, City Budget Officer, Ms. Mey Gomez, Acting City Accountant, and Ms. Jasmin Maagad, City Treasurer.
June is declared the Philippine Environment pursuant to Proclamation No. 237, s. 1988 by late President Corazon Aquino. (FDCalotes/SP)
